Literature summary for 5.3.99.2 extracted from

  • Mathurin, K.; Gallant, M.A.; Germain, P.; Allard-Chamard, H.; Brisson, J.; Iorio-Morin, C.; de Brum Fernandes, A.; Caron, M.G.; Laporte, S.A.; Parent, J.L.
    An interaction between L-prostaglandin D synthase and arrestin increases PGD2 production (2011), J. Biol. Chem., 286, 2696-2706.
    View publication on PubMedView publication on EuropePMC

Activating Compound

Activating Compound Comment Organism Structure
arrestin-3 arrestin-3 promotes prostaglandin D2 production by L-PGDS in vitro. Incubation of L-PGDS with arrestin-3 amino acids 56-100 enhances prostaglandin D2 production by 145% Homo sapiens
